Preparation of stock solutions
1. Zn (CH3COO)2: • Mass: 0.0548 g • 50 mL volumetric flask • Concentration: 5 mM 2. NH4 (CH3COO): • Mass: 0.0385 g • 100 mL volumetric flask • Concentration: 5 mM 3. Na2S: • Mass: 0.0390 g • 100 mL volumetric flask • Concentration: 5 mM 4. CH3COOH: Concentrated Reagent: Acetic Acid 99.5 %, Molarity: 17.5 mol/L • Volume: 28.7 µL • 50 mL volumetric flask • Concentration: 10 mM • Volume: 287 µL • 50 mL volumetric flask • Concentration: 100 mM 5. NH4OH: Concentrated Reagent: Ammonium Hydroxide 30%, Density: 0.895 g/mL • Volume: 39.150 µL • 100 Ml volumetric flask • Concentration: 10 mM
• Mass: 0.2 g • 50 mL volumetric flask • Concentration: 100 mM .
